France Brittany: Index of all pages Modern flag of Brittany (Gwenn-ha-Du) The modern Breton flag, called in Breton Gwenn-ha-Du(white and Black) is made of nine horizontal stripes, in turn black and white, and of 11 eleven black ermine spots, placed 4 + 3 + 4.

How is the Breton flag used in France?

The flag is commonly flown on private boats used for sailing and fishing, which is acceptable, provided the French national ensignis also flown. The Breton spationaut Jean-Louis Chrétien brought the flag in the space shuttle. Pascal Vagnat, 13 January 1997

Why did Morvan Marchal create the Brittany flag?

The flag was created in 1923 by Morvan Marchal. He used as his inspiration the flags of the United States and Greece as these two countries were seen at that time as the respective symbols of liberty and democracy. The nine horizontal stripes represent the traditional dioceses of Brittany into which the duchy was divided historically.

What does the flag of Bretagne region mean?

Flag of Region Bretagne. The word “Bretagne”, placed on the edge of the square, represents openmindness. The logo can be used in black and white, countercoloured on a dark background, monochromous (green background and white ermine spot and lettering); the writing can appear in Breton, as “Rannvro BREIZH”.
